From 8398d7ef7e3de08469aa6837c0f67c573f1b96f5 Mon Sep 17 00:00:00 2001 From: Steveice10 <1269164+Steveice10@users.noreply.github.com> Date: Fri, 26 Jan 2024 15:46:37 -0800 Subject: [PATCH] arm64: Fix compiling under MSYS2 CLANGARM64. --- src/dynarmic/backend/arm64/devirtualize.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/dynarmic/backend/arm64/devirtualize.h b/src/dynarmic/backend/arm64/devirtualize.h index 14057db5..c433fd01 100644 --- a/src/dynarmic/backend/arm64/devirtualize.h +++ b/src/dynarmic/backend/arm64/devirtualize.h @@ -47,7 +47,7 @@ DevirtualizedCall DevirtualizeDefault(mcl::class_type* this_) { template DevirtualizedCall Devirtualize(mcl::class_type* this_) { -#if defined(_WIN32) +#if defined(_WIN32) && defined(_MSC_VER) return DevirtualizeWindows(this_); #else return DevirtualizeDefault(this_);